Increased Accessibility
One of the primary benefits of automatic doors is the enhancement of accessibility. These doors are particularly beneficial for individuals with disabilities or those carrying heavy items, as they eliminate the need for physical effort to open them. According to the World Health Organization, nearly one billion people worldwide experience some form of disability. This statistic highlights the importance of creating facilities that are accessible to everyone. With automatic doors, businesses demonstrate their commitment to inclusivity and customer service.
Automatic doors streamline entry and exit for all customers, reducing wait times during busy hours. By allowing for a seamless flow of foot traffic, they enhance the overall shopping experience, encouraging customer retention and repeat visits. When installing an automatic door, businesses often notice an uptick in footfall due to the convenience they provide.
Improved Energy Efficiency
Another significant advantage of automatic doors is their contribution to energy efficiency in commercial buildings. These doors can help maintain consistent indoor temperatures, reducing the strain on HVAC systems. According to the U.S. Department of Energy, automatic doors can reduce energy costs by up to 30%. This is achieved by minimizing the amount of air that escapes when people enter or exit, which is particularly important in establishments like grocery stores and restaurants where climate control is crucial for both comfort and food safety.
Many automatic doors are equipped with sensors that ensure they only open when someone approaches, further helping to conserve energy. This technology not only benefits the environment but also results in cost savings for businesses, making a compelling case for installing automatic doors as a part of an energy-efficient approach. Enhanced Security Measures
Automatic doors can also bolster security in commercial buildings. Many of these systems can be integrated with access control technologies, such as key cards or biometric scanners, ensuring that only authorized personnel can enter restricted areas. This capability is particularly beneficial for businesses that maintain sensitive information or valuable assets. Additionally, the design of automatic doors allows for quick, unobstructed access and exit during emergencies, thus improving safety protocols. In emergency situations, the swift operation of automatic doors can facilitate a smooth evacuation, potentially saving lives and preventing chaos. These security features make automatic doors a worthwhile investment for businesses looking to enhance their safety measures.
Operational Efficiency
Automatic doors contribute significantly to the operational efficiency of commercial spaces. By providing easier entry and exit points, businesses can reduce the amount of time employees spend opening and closing doors. In high-traffic areas, this efficiency can translate into significant time savings over the course of a working day. Moreover, employees are less likely to be interrupted by customers struggling to enter or exit, allowing them to attend to their tasks better. When the workflow within a commercial building is smooth, overall productivity improves, leading to higher customer satisfaction and potentially increasing revenue.
Design Flexibility and Aesthetic Appeal
Beyond the practical advantages, automatic doors offer design flexibility and aesthetic appeal. They are available in various styles, materials, and finishes, allowing businesses to choose options that align with their branding and architectural design. Whether it’s a sleek glass door for a modern office or a sturdy aluminum entrance for a warehouse, there are solutions to match every aesthetic preference. This versatility also means that companies can utilize automatic doors to create a welcoming atmosphere for customers. A visually appealing entrance not only attracts customers but also expresses the company’s commitment to quality and sophistication. The psychological impact of an inviting entrance should not be underestimated, as first impressions can significantly affect consumer behavior.
